Definitions of steeplejack word
- noun steeplejack a person who climbs steeples, towers, or the like, to build or repair them. 1
- noun steeplejack person who builds steeples 1
- noun steeplejack a person trained and skilled in the construction and repair of steeples, chimneys, etc 0
- noun steeplejack a person whose work is building, painting, or repairing steeples, smokestacks, etc. 0

Origin of steeplejack
First appearance:
before 1880 One of the 23% newest English words
First recorded in 1880-85; steeple + jack1
